Transaction 72c817797131f6dc0bcf1e63e81494ebb82ee87d2a0a1c7a0f5387d642bf9f88
1 Input
1 Output
-
72c817797131f6dc0bcf1e63e81494ebb82ee87d2a0a1c7a0f5387d642bf9f88:0
- value
- 4104193
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a489768edd5df93ae10afaca916e83c93b0137e2 OP_EQUAL
- address
- 3Gh1R7GCrCDUqL9n5ivYpt11tP5daZDfVi